Algorithmic Trading Strategies

For many investors, the concept of automated trading strategies can seem shrouded in mystery. However, these strategies simply involve utilizing computer programs to execute trades based on predefined rules and parameters. By removing emotion from the equation, automated trading aims to maximize returns while reducing risk.

There are various types of automated trading strategies available, each with its own unique approach to market analysis and trade execution. Some popular examples include trend-following strategies, mean reversion strategies, and arbitrage strategies.

  • Comprehending the mechanics of automated trading can empower investors to make more informed decisions about their investment portfolios.
  • By leveraging sophisticated algorithms, these strategies can scan vast amounts of market data and identify profitable possibilities that may be missed by human traders.

Regardless of the potential benefits, it's crucial to approach automated trading with caution. Thorough research, meticulous backtesting, and a well-defined risk management plan are essential for success in this dynamic and ever-evolving market landscape.

Evaluating Automated Trading Systems

Before diving into the live markets with an automated trading system, rigorous simulation is paramount. This process involves running your strategy on historical data to assess its effectiveness in various market conditions. By meticulously analyzing the results, you can highlight strengths and weaknesses, ultimately leading to improvement. Optimization aims to refine your system's parameters, such as risk management, to maximize its returns while minimizing losses. A well-optimized strategy will demonstrate consistent results even in fluctuating market environments.

  • Additionally, it's crucial to conduct thorough risk management analysis during backtesting to ensure your system can survive market shocks.
  • In conclusion, the combination of robust backtesting and continuous optimization is essential for developing profitable and sustainable automated trading approaches.

Navigating the Regulatory Terrain of Algorithmic Trading

The realm of automated trading presents a complex legal challenge. As algorithmic systems increasingly drive market movements, regulatory bodies grapple with issues such as transparency and the potential for systemic risk. Deciphering this evolving legal structure is vital for players in the automated trading sector to ensure compliance and mitigate liability.

A key focus of regulators is deterring unlawful activity. Algorithmic trading systems, while capable of executing trades at high speeds, can also be misused for price rigging. Regulatory frameworks are constantly evolving to counter these challenges and protect the integrity of financial markets.

  • Financial authorities worldwide are adopting new rules and standards to govern automated trading practices.
  • Disclosure requirements are being enhanced to shed light on the mechanisms of algorithmic trading strategies.
  • Observance with these regulations is crucial for all participants in the automated trading market to mitigate legal penalties and reputational damage.
